My interview with the comedian Sarah Silverman is in the Guardian's Weekend magazine tomorrow (update: and now here); could there possibly be a better way to spend part of your Saturday than reading it?

Today is also the start of The Great Schlep, the very clever lobbying effort that Silverman promoted in a video I posted here a little while ago. Organised by the pro-Obama Jewish Council for Education and Research, it involves young Jews travelling to Florida to persuade their grandparents -- who've been reluctant to support Obama, but who certainly love their grandchildren -- to vote Democratic in November. As the South Florida Sun-Sentinel reports, the first schleppers have already arrived, and didn't waste time in resorting to extreme measures:

Ari Kuschnir, 28, of Brooklyn... arrived earlier this week and was unable to talk his grandmother into voting for Obama. So he promised to get engaged to his girlfriend of four years if she changes her vote and Obama wins.

Now that's commitment to a cause.

Silverman is performing at the Hammersmith Apollo in London later this month.
